About Manitowaning, Ontario

Manitowaning is a compact rural community in Manitoulin, Ontario, Canada. It is classified as a town. Manitowaning is located at 45.7427°N, 81.8091°W. It observes Eastern Time (UTC−5 / −4). Postal code area: P0P.

Manitowaning rests upon the limestone shelf of The Rock, its low-slung buildings gazing out toward the expansive, steel-blue waters of North Channel. It lies 27.8 km south-south-east of Little Current, ON (from Little Current, ON: bearing 161°T), and is situated 10.1 km south-west of Wikwemikong. The history of Manitowaning is marked by its position as the first European settlement on its island, established with a focus on the harbor’s natural shelter.
